CPU <--->寄存器 <--->缓存<--->内存 当寄存器没有从缓存中读取到数据时,也就是没有命中,那么就从内存中读取数据。 2.2、一级缓存和二级缓存 CPU读取数据的顺序为先缓存后内存。 CPU内部集成的缓存称为一级缓存(L1 Cache),外部的称为二级缓存(L2 Cache)。 一级缓存中又分为数据缓存(D-Cache)和指令缓...
Cache又分为一级Cache(L1 Cache)和二级Cache(L2 Cache),L1 Cache集成在CPU内部,L2 Cache早期一般是焊在主板上,现在也都集成在CPU内部,常见的容量有256KB或512KB L2 Cache。 总结:大致来说数据是通过内存-Cache-寄存器,Cache缓存则是为了弥补CPU与内存之间运算速度的差异而设置的的部件。 首先看一下计算机的存储...
寄存器(Cache)是CPU内部集成的,内存是挂在CPU外面的数据总线上的,访问内存时要在CPU的寄存器(Cache)填上地址,再执行相应的汇编指令,这时CPU会在数据总线上生成读取或写入内存数据的时钟信号,最终内存的内容会被CPU寄存器(Cache)的内容更新(写入)或者被读入CPU的寄存器(Cache)(读取)。如图: CPU、内存、寄存器之间的关...
然后寄存器往下就是各级的cache,有L1 cache,L2,甚至有L3的,以及TLB这些(TLB也可以认为是cache),之后就是内存,前面说寄存器快,现在说为什么这些慢: 对于各级的cache,访问速度是不同的,理论上说L1cache(一级缓存)有着跟CPU寄存器相同的速度,但L1cache有一个问题,当需要同步cache和内存之间的内容时,需要锁住cache的...
下列为CPU存取速度的比较,正确的是( )。A.Cache>寄存>寄存器B.Cache>寄存器>内存C.寄存器>Cache>内存D.寄存器>内存>Cache
现代计算机的存储体系结构由内存和外存构成, 内存包括寄存器、 cache 、主存储器和硬 盘,它们读写速度快,生产成本高。
计算机系统的存储介质包括寄存器、Cache、内存和硬盘,其中成本最低、访问速度最慢的是( )。 A.寄存器B.CacheC.硬盘D.内存
A.CacheB.寄存器C.内存D.外存相关知识点: 试题来源: 解析 B存取速度从快到慢的有储器依次为寄存器、Cache、内存、外存,所以答案应选B。 [解析]寄存器是PU的组成部分,高速缓存只是集成到PU封装,内存完全是和PU独立的。所以在存取速度上寄存器最快,高速缓存次之,内存比高速缓存慢,外存最慢。
寄存器(Cache)是CPU内部集成的,内存是挂在CPU外面的数据总线上的,访问内存时要在CPU的寄存器(Cache)填上地址,再执行相应的汇编指令,这时CPU会在数据总线上生成读取或写入内存数据的时钟信号,最终内存的内容会被CPU寄存器(Cache)的内容更新(写入)或者被读入CPU的寄存器(Cache)(...
百度试题 题目CPU存取速度的比较,下列哪个是正确的( ) A. Cache>内存>寄存器 B. Cache>寄存器>内存 C. 寄存器>Cache>内存 D. 寄存器>内存>Cache 相关知识点: 试题来源: 解析 C.寄存器>Cache>内存